composer fund 命令是做什么的?

穿越時空
发布: 2025-11-19 15:00:01
原创
543人浏览过
composer fund 不是有效命令,仅是安装含 funding 字段的包时显示的提示,用于鼓励资助开源维护者,实际执行会报错,需手动访问链接支持。

composer fund 命令是做什么的?

Composer 并没有 fund 这个命令。

截至目前(Composer 2.x 稳定版本),composer fund 不是一个标准或内置的 Composer 命令。你可能在执行某个项目时看到过这个提示,是因为某些 PHP 包在安装或更新时,会通过 Composer 的插件机制输出一条“fund”信息,鼓励用户资助开源维护者。

为什么会出现 "fund" 信息?

一些开源包在 composer.json 中定义了 funding 字段,例如:

{
    "funding": [
        {
            "type": "github",
            "url": "https://github.com/sponsors/nikic"
        },
        {
            "type": "opencollective",
            "url": "https://opencollective.com/phpunit"
        }
    ]
}
登录后复制

当使用 composer installcomposer update 安装这些包时,Composer 会检测到 funding 信息,并在终端中显示一行提示,比如:

Funding for package foo/bar: https://example.com/sponsor
登录后复制

这只是一个提示性信息,不是可执行的命令。

微信二级防封域名
微信二级防封域名

防封域名方法千千种,我们只做最简单且有用的这一种。微信域名防封是指通过技术手段来实现预付措施,一切说自己完全可以防封的那都是不可能的,一切说什么免死域名不会死的那也是吹牛逼的。我们正在做的是让我们的推广域名寿命更长一点,成本更低一点,效果更好一点。本源码采用 ASP+ACCESS 搭建,由于要用到二级域名,所以需要使用独享云虚机或者云服务器,不支持虚拟主机使用,不支持本地测试。目前这是免费测试版,

微信二级防封域名 0
查看详情 微信二级防封域名

那可以执行 composer fund 吗?

不可以。如果你运行 composer fund,会得到错误提示:

[InvalidArgumentException]  
Command "fund" is not defined.  
Did you mean one of these?  
  dump-autoload  
  install  
  require  
  update  
  ...
登录后复制

总结

composer fund 并不是一个真正的命令。它只是开发者看到的一个视觉提示,用于支持开源项目维护者。Composer 本身不会执行任何资助操作,也不会提供一个叫 fund 的子命令。

如果你想支持某个项目,可以手动访问其 funding 链接,比如 GitHub Sponsors、Open Collective 等平台进行捐赠。

基本上就这些。看到 fund 提示,知道它是善意提醒就行,不用特别操作。

以上就是composer fund 命令是做什么的?的详细内容,更多请关注php中文网其它相关文章!

最佳 Windows 性能的顶级免费优化软件
最佳 Windows 性能的顶级免费优化软件

每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。

下载
来源:php中文网
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
最新问题
开源免费商场系统广告
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号